Did you hear the one about the kosher search engine?

If I hadn't read about it on NYTimes.com this morning, I would have thought Koogle was the punchline to one of those email jokes my mother-in-law is always forwarding to me and the rest of our extended family. You know the kind:

Avi: Did you hear some Israelis invented a kosher search engine?

Shmuel: No! Really? What is it called?

Avi: Koogle!

But the recently launched "kosher," ultra-Orthodox-rabbi-approved Israeli search engine is for real -- and you can find it at http://www.koogle.co.il/. FYI, it helps if you read Hebrew.

While Koogle can probably help you find the nearest mikvah or a good kugel recipe, it will not display religiously objectionable material, such as pictures of scantily clad women. (Think more Golda Meir.) There is also no searching on the Sabbath (though I am assuming this would be Israeli Sabbath hours).
